4.11
Removal of Engine.
To remove engine from pump
and base assembly, follow the below procedure.
4.11.1
Remove pump casing and adapter (4.10.1 -- 4.10.11).
4.11.2
Remove engine from base by removing 4 mounting bolts
previously loosened.
4.11.3
Lift engine from base.
Replace in reverse order.

Section V
REPLACEMENT OF MONITOR ELMENTS
The monitor elements
may be replaced without disassembling any other component of the
--
system. (Naturally, it is recommended that the monitor and pump
be drained of fuel and all hoses removed from the unit.)
a.
Unscrew locking handle at the rear of the monitor (turn
c o u n t e r c l o c k w i s e ) .  This will force the rear cover of
the monitor off.
Elements (fuses) may then be removed by pulling each
b.
straight out of the cylinder.
Re-insert new elements by hand. Five are required.
c.
d.
Replace the "O" ring sealing the rear cover assembly.
Lubricate the "O" ring with SAE 30 motor oil.
e.
f.
Install the rear cover, using caution not to pinch or cut
the "O" ring.  IT IS IMPORTANT THAT THE REAR COVER
B E REPLACED GRADUALLY BY ALTERNATE TAPPING
OF COVER AND TURNING THE LOCKING HANDLE TO
PREVENT DAMAGE OF THE "O" RING OR MISALIGN-
MENT OF THE COVER.
